inpudator
TypeScript icon, indicating that this package has built-in type declarations

0.0.0 • Public • Published

Inpudator

Input validation for vanila javascript

Get Started

Install Inpudator to your project.

pnpm install inpudator

Example

Simple login validation example.

import inpudator from "inpudator";

// define validation schema
const validations = {
  name: inpudator("username", "example", {
    min: 4,
    small: true
  }),
  password: inpudator("password", "Example123@", {
    min: 4,
    small: true,
    special: true
  })
};

if (validations.name.valid && validations.password.valid) {
 console.log("You are great!");
} else {
  console.log(validations.name.first);
  console.log(validations.password.first);
}

Dependencies (0)

    Dev Dependencies (3)

    Package Sidebar

    Install

    npm i inpudator

    Weekly Downloads

    2

    Version

    0.0.0

    License

    MIT

    Unpacked Size

    6.01 kB

    Total Files

    7

    Last publish

    Collaborators

    • mdmahikaishar001